血清Lp-PLA2、NSE水平与急性脑梗死患者神经损伤程度、脂质代谢改变的相关性研究 被引量:8

Correlation study of serum Lp-PLA2 and NSE levels with nerve injury degree and lipid metabolism change in patients with acute cerebral infarction

摘要 目的:研究血清Lp-PLA2、NSE水平与急性脑梗死患者神经损伤程度、脂质代谢改变的相关性。方法:选择2014年3月~2016年10月期间在南方医科大学附属小榄医院诊断为急性脑梗死的患者作为研究的脑梗死组、同期体检的健康者作为对照组。采集血清并测定Lp-PLA2、NSE水平以及神经损伤分子、脂质代谢分子的含量。结果:脑梗死组患者血清中Lp-PLA2、NSE、NO、MDA、LPO、8-OHdG、ox-LDL、LDL-C、ApoB的水平均显著高于对照组,HDL-C、ApoA1的含量显著低于对照组;NSE>Q3患者血清中NO、MDA、LPO、8-OHdG的含量显著高于<Q1、Q1-Q2、Q2-Q3患者,Q2-Q3患者血清中NO、MDA、LPO、8-OHdG的含量显著高于<Q1、Q1-Q2,Q1-Q2患者血清中NO、MDA、LPO、8-OHdG的含量显著高于<Q1;Lp-PLA2>Q3患者血清中ox-LDL、LDL-C、ApoB的含量显著高于<Q1、Q1-Q2、Q2-Q3患者,HDL-C、ApoA1的含量显著低于<Q1、Q1-Q2、Q2-Q3患者;Q2-Q3患者血清中oxLDL、LDL-C、ApoB的含量显著高于<Q1、Q1-Q2患者,HDL-C、ApoA1的含量显著低于<Q1、Q1-Q2患者;Q1-Q2患者血清中ox-LDL、LDL-C、ApoB的含量显著高于<Q1患者,HDL-C、ApoA1的含量显著低于<Q1患者。结论:急性脑梗死患者血清Lp-PLA2、NSE水平显著升高,Lp-PLA2的升高与脂质代谢异常有关、NSE的升高与神经氧化损伤有关。 Objective:To study the correlation of serum Lp-PLA2 and NSE levels with nerve injury degree and lipid metabolism change in patients with acute cerebral infarction.Methods:Patients diagnosed with acute cerebral infarction in our hospital between March 2014 and October 2016 were selected as the cerebral infarction group of the study,and healthy subjects receiving physical examination during the same period were selected as control group.Serum was collected to determine the levels of Lp-PLA2 and NSE as well as the content of nerve injury molecules and lipid metabolism molecules.Results:Serum Lp-PLA2,NSE,NO,MDA,LPO,8-OHdG,ox-LDL,LDL-C and ApoB levels of cerebral infarction group were significantly higher than those of control group while HDL-C and ApoA1 content were significantly lower than those of control group;serum NO,MDA,LPO and 8-OHdG content of patients with NSE〉Q3 were significantly higher than those of patients with Q1,Q1-Q2 and Q2-Q3,serum NO,MDA,LPO and 8-OHdG content of patients with Q2-Q3 were significantly higher than those of patients with〈Q1and Q1-Q2,and serum NO,MDA,LPO and 8-OHdG content of patients with Q1-Q2 were significantly higher than those of patients with〈Q1;serum ox-LDL,LDL-C and ApoB content of patients with Lp-PLA2〉Q3were significantly higher than those of patients with Q1,Q1-Q2 and Q2-Q3 while HDL-C and ApoA1 content were significantly lower than those of patients with〈Q1,Q1-Q2 and Q2-Q3;serum ox-LDL,LDL-C and ApoB content of patients with Q2-Q3 were significantly higher than those of patients with〈Q1 and Q1-Q2 while HDL-C and ApoA1 content were significantly lower than those of patients with〈Q1 and Q1-Q2;serum ox-LDL,LDL-C and ApoB content of patients with Q1-Q2 were significantly higher than those of patients with〈Q1 while HDL-C and ApoA1 content were significantly lower than those of patients with Q1.Conclusions:Serum Lp-PLA2 and NSE levels increase significantly in patients with acute cerebral infarction,the increase of Lp-PLA2 is associated with abnormal lipid metabolism,and the increase of NSE is associated with neural oxidative damage.
